Identifying Turbidity Issues
The first step in addressing turbidity in your home is recognizing its presence. Use your senses to identify signs of turbidity:
- A cloudy appearance in drinking water.
- Unpleasant odors or tastes.
- Visible particles or sediment settling in a glass after a short time.
Once you suspect a turbidity issue, conducting a water test can help confirm your concerns. Homeowners can easily acquire water testing kits designed to identify turbidity levels along with other potential contaminants.
How to Conduct a Water Test
Using a water testing kit is straightforward. Follow these steps for a reliable test:
- Fill a clean sample bottle with water from your tap.
- Follow the kit instructions to measure turbidity, often indicated by a turbidity scale.
- Compare results to acceptable ranges; most kits will indicate whether levels are of concern.
If your results reveal elevated turbidity levels, it’s crucial to explore treatment options to enhance water clarity and quality.
Benefits of Sediment Filtration Systems
One of the most effective methods for treating turbidity in residential water supplies is through sediment filtration. These systems can efficiently remove particles, dirt, and other contaminants, ensuring your water is both clear and safe for consumption.
Here’s why sediment filtration is a popular choice:
- Effective Removal: Sediment filters are specifically designed to capture particles down to microns in size, making them adept at addressing turbidity caused by sediment.
- Long-Term Solutions: These systems provide a durable and long-lasting solution, requiring minimal maintenance if adequately sized and installed.
Understanding Equipment Sizing
Choosing the right sediment filtration system is crucial for optimal performance. Factors to consider include:
- Flow Rate: Determine the flow rate your household requires. This is often measured in gallons per minute (GPM) and should align with your daily water usage.
- Grain Capacity: Grain capacity relates to how much sediment the filter can effectively handle before needing to be replaced or cleaned.
- Tank Size: The size of the filtration tank should be compatible with your household's consumption to ensure consistent water clarity.
Before purchasing, it’s essential to assess each of these factors to avoid under- or over-sizing your filtration system.
Maintenance and Care
Regular maintenance of your sediment filter is vital for its longevity and effectiveness. Follow these guidelines:
- Check filter cartridges periodically—replacement intervals vary based on water quality and usage but typically range from every six months to a year.
- Inspect for any leaks or signs of wear to address potential issues proactively.
- Keep a maintenance log to track changes and replacements, ensuring your system operates optimally.
Common Mistakes to Avoid
When dealing with turbidity and sediment filtration, be mindful of these common pitfalls:
- Not conducting regular water tests to monitor turbidity levels post-installation.
- Choosing a filtration system based solely on initial cost without considering long-term efficiency and effectiveness.
- Underestimating flow rate needs, which can result in inadequate filtration and continued turbidity issues.

Understanding Different Filtration Technologies
When selecting a sediment filtration system, it is beneficial to understand the various technologies available. Here are the most common types:
- Mechanical Filters: These filters use physical barriers to remove sediment and particulate matter from water. They are effective for larger particles and often come in various micron ratings.
- Media Filters: Utilizing various filter media like sand, gravel, or Activated Carbon, these filters can capture a wide range of sediment sizes and improve water quality through absorption.
- Centrifugal Separators: By using centrifugal force, these systems separate sediment from water. This technology is particularly efficient for handling large volumes of water in industrial settings.
Implementing Pre-Filtration Systems
In some cases, it may be beneficial to implement a pre-filtration system before the main sediment filter. This can help prolong the life of your sediment filter and enhance overall system performance. Options for pre-filtration include:
- Screen Filters: These filters remove larger debris prior to sediment filtration, making the main filter more efficient.
- Sand Filters: Commonly used in more extensive systems, these can handle larger sediment loads effectively and are excellent for preliminary treatment.
Considerations for Choosing a Location
The installation location of your filtration system can significantly affect its operation and efficiency. Key points to consider include:
- Accessibility: Ensure the system is easy to access for regular maintenance and cartridge changes.
- Proximity to Water Supply: Situate the filter close to the main water supply line to reduce potential pressure drop.
- Environmental Factors: Avoid areas with extreme temperatures or moisture levels that could affect the system's durability.
